Brian Walshe murder trial: Slain wife Ana's lover takes the stand
Share and Follow

Ana Walshe’s lover, William Fastow, took the witness stand on Thursday during the murder trial of her husband, Brian Walshe. Fastow revealed that their “intimate” relationship began before her mysterious disappearance on January 1, 2023.

Fastow, who works as a realtor, had assisted Ana in securing a place to live in Washington, D.C., where she traveled for work while still residing with her family in Boston.

In his testimony, Fastow mentioned that he, too, had children and was living separately from his wife at the time.

Fastow recounted how their connection deepened as they discovered shared interests in fitness and the challenges of parenting, leading eventually to their romantic involvement.

Although he never stayed at her Washington townhouse overnight, she stayed at his, he said. He said he did not keep the affair a secret generally, but that Ana had told him that if her husband ever found out, she wanted him to find out from her.

Still, the two went on a trip to Dublin, Ireland, for Thanksgiving in the months before her murder. After Dublin, Ana flew to Serbia to visit her mother, while he returned to Washington. They also spent Christmas Eve together in Washington, he said, allegedly infuriating her husband when her flight was delayed. She drove from Washington to Cohasset.

She had also set up rooms for her three children in her townhouse, he said, anticipating that they would be moving in there.

“Ana was extremely disappointed that she wasn’t in a position to be the mother she believed the children deserved,” Fastow testified.

He testified that Ana told him that her children lived with their father in Cohasset, a suburb of Boston, because Walshe’s home confinement for a federal art fraud conviction was contingent on him being their primary caretaker.

Prosecutors have alleged two potential motives in the slaying. The first is anger over the affair. The second is because he allegedly believed he would have a better chance of avoiding federal prison if his wife were out of the picture, and he was the only caretaker for their three children.

Walshe’s defense has denied that he had any knowledge of the affair, although he mentioned Fastow more than once during interviews with detectives before his arrest and allegedly looked him up on the internet before Ana’s disappearance.

During cross-examination, Walshe’s defense attorney repeatedly referred to Ana as “Mrs. Walshe” to underscore how Fastow was carrying on an affair with a married mother of three. 

Her remains have not been found, but prosecutors showed the jury Wednesday a saw and hatchet recovered from a dumpster near Walshe’s mother’s house that the defendant allegedly used to dismember his wife. The same dumpster also had her COVID-19 vaccination card, clothes, bloody towels and a cut-up rug suspiciously similar to one taken from the family home.

Janet Cotter, a woman who ran into Ana at a nail salon on Dec. 31, 2022, testified that Ana was friendly and warm and was excited to attend a New Year’s Day dinner with her husband in the north shore town of Marblehead. Once she realized Ana was missing, she said, she called Cohasset police and alerted them to their conversation. 

The general manager of the Clairmount apartment complex, where Walshe’s mother lived and where prosecutors say police found bags of tools and Ana’s clothing, took the stand and confirmed she provided police with surveillance footage from the property. 

She testified the property has four outside cameras, three of which focus on the back of the building where two gated areas contain the building’s dumpsters.

Prosecutors played some of the video, which had several time skips but showed a man alleged to be Walshe getting out of a Volvo like the one he drove and throwing heavy bags into the dumpster.
